Transaction b18fc549041d307e70fdb43c650489588c40b9472553af75f79e628793127cc7
2 Input
2 Outputs
- b18fc549041d307e70fdb43c650489588c40b9472553af75f79e628793127cc7:0
- b18fc549041d307e70fdb43c650489588c40b9472553af75f79e628793127cc7:1
value 18349626
address 3BvF4qutNcTwLa3sh8EzQDdaX6o1yLBupu
value 859830
address 3BMEXfFF75gmsTYUojVGWBAE2bWjMm2WWt